Ten Years at WFSB

HAPPY NEW YEAR!!
WOW, can you imagine I've been with WFSB for 10 years ! What a wonderful journey its been. It isn't about the destination, it's all about the journey. So let me take this opportunity to thank you, our loyal viewers and extended family for making WFSB your choice for local news. I'm so proud to be a part of the team.
In January 1998, Channel 3 put their faith in me in providing you coverage of the Holy Father's historic meeting with President Fidel Castro of Cuba. Soon after my return, WFSB selected me to anchor Eyewitness News during the weekends. We launched the Eyewitness News Bureau in New London to better inform viewers in the growing counties in New London and Windham.
2008 will bring even more opportunities for Eyewitness News and the viewers we serve.
